Profile
Sonsoles Centeno joined Pérez-Llorca in 2021 as a partner in the Administrative Law and European Union Law practice areas. She is a State Advocate on leave of absence. She advises clients on regulatory matters, and has particular experience in litigation before the courts of the European Union and before the Spanish contentious-administrative courts. She focuses on matters concerning sanctioning, energy and sustainability, trade and investment, digital markets, State aid and public procurement.

Experience
Sonsoles was responsible for the opening of the firm’s Brussels office, and has advised her clients on proceedings before the European Commission and before the EU Courts, particularly in relation to State aid and internal market matters, and especially public procurement.
Prior to joining the firm, she amassed more than 18 years of experience through various positions within the public administration, particularly in the field of the European Union. She has been Chief State Advocate before the Court of Justice of the European Union (Ministry of Foreign Affairs, European Union and Cooperation) and Agent of the Kingdom of Spain, State Advocate-Legal Adviser at the Permanent Representation of Spain to the European Union and State Advocate before the National High Court (Administrative Chamber).
